Tramadol hydrochloride/acetaminophen tablets are a combination medication used to treat moderate to moderately severe pain. Tramadol is an opioid pain medication that works by binding to the mu-opioid receptors in the brain to reduce the sensation of pain, while acetaminophen is a non-opioid pain medication that works by blocking the production of prostaglandins, which can cause pain and inflammation.

This combination medication is prescribed by a healthcare provider for short-term pain relief, typically after surgery or for conditions such as back pain, dental pain, or arthritis. The dosage and frequency of administration will depend on the individual’s pain level, medical history, and tolerance to opioids.

It is important to take this medication as prescribed and to avoid exceeding the recommended dosage. Taking too much of this medication can increase the risk of serious side effects, including liver damage and respiratory depression. In addition, this medication can be habit-forming and should only be taken under the guidance of a healthcare provider.

If you experience any unusual symptoms or side effects while taking tramadol hydrochloride/acetaminophen tablets, you should contact your healthcare provider right away.
